Diamond makes a nice bow, some are more comfortable to hold, its all a matter of what works for the archer. I just looked at the Black Ice two nights ago and the Rock, didnt like the grip of the Rock just a personal preference.I tried all the major manufacturers shopping for my bow (Mathers, Hoyt, Bowtech, Diamond, Bear, and Martin) I ended upbuying a Hoyt, but would have been equally happy with several others.

Like you said, whatever gets him out with you and works for him in accuracy is what matters most. Diamond makes a good bow. As long as it was set up right it will work.
